Is it possible to change the rear bumper of a 79 and put a 81 rear bumper?

Yes, with the correct tail lights and the TL mounts.

I put the 80-82 bumper on my '77 with no problems. I did have to leave off 2 metal brackets with rubber strips on them as they stuck out to far so the bumper wouldn't bolt up otherwise. Your '79 should be the same.

I agree.

I bought the fiberglass bumper from Ecklers for 350.00.
Mounting was another 300.00 - Fit was very good.
Paint at Macco was another 300.00 - I did some of the sanding myself, but they did need to do extra prep before painting.

If you go with a new urethane bumper...which will fit up very easily due to it being able to flex. If it comes in raw...with no primer...please be careful when handling it and also when you go to prep it and prime it before painting. DO NOT apply/wipe any type of solvent on it...or it can make the urethane swell. There are specifically made products just for dealing with a raw urethane part that needs to be primed. This is NOT an opinion...but a FACT.
